Women's Tennis Clipped in Close Match at Colby-Sawyer

NEW LONDON, N.H. – The Wheaton College women's tennis team dropped a 5-4 decision in a close match at Colby-Sawyer on Sunday.

Colby-Sawyer opened the match with a sweep in doubles action.

In singles action, the Lyons tried to gain control of the momentum as first-year Ines de Bracamonte secured a 6-0, 6-2 victory in the No. 1 spot to get things going. Senior Caroline DiNicola-Fawley went on to earn a 6-4, 2-6, 10-3 win over Colby-Sawyer in the No. 4 spot as junior Michelle Trainor won at No. 5 at 6-1, 6-0 and first-year Connor O'Keefe notched her 8-5 victory in the No. 6 spot, but that wouldn't be enough as Colby-Sawyer would hang on for the 5-4 match win.

The Lyons close out the 2015-16 season on Friday as they host Holy Cross at the Clark Tennis Courts.
